首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Prometheus Python查看公制的当前值

Prometheus是一种开源的监控系统和时间序列数据库,用于记录和查询各种应用程序的指标数据。它使用拉取模型来收集数据,通过HTTP协议从目标应用程序暴露的接口获取指标数据。Prometheus提供了一个功能强大的查询语言PromQL,可以用于灵活地查询和分析指标数据。

Python是一种高级编程语言,被广泛用于开发各种应用程序和服务。在云计算领域,Python常被用于编写和管理云原生应用程序、自动化任务、数据处理和分析等。

查看公制的当前值是指通过Prometheus和Python来获取和展示公制单位(如温度、湿度、压力等)的实时数值。以下是一个示例代码,展示如何使用Prometheus和Python来查看公制的当前值:

代码语言:txt
复制
from prometheus_api_client import PrometheusConnect

# 创建Prometheus连接
prometheus_url = 'http://prometheus.example.com'
prometheus = PrometheusConnect(url=prometheus_url)

# 查询公制的当前值
metric_name = 'temperature_celsius'
query = f'{metric_name}{{unit="celsius"}}'
result = prometheus.custom_query(query)

# 打印结果
print(f'当前{metric_name}的值为: {result}')

在上述示例中,我们使用了prometheus_api_client库来与Prometheus进行交互。首先,我们创建了一个Prometheus连接,并指定Prometheus的URL。然后,我们构建了一个查询,查询指定单位为摄氏度的温度值。最后,我们通过调用custom_query方法来执行查询,并打印结果。

对于公制的当前值的应用场景,可以包括但不限于以下几个方面:

  1. 温度监控:通过获取温度传感器的数据,并使用Prometheus和Python来查看当前的温度值。
  2. 环境监测:通过获取湿度传感器、压力传感器等数据,并使用Prometheus和Python来查看当前的湿度和压力值。
  3. 工业自动化:在工业生产过程中,通过获取各种传感器的数据,并使用Prometheus和Python来实时监测和控制各种参数。

腾讯云提供了一系列与监控和数据分析相关的产品,可以与Prometheus和Python结合使用,以实现更全面的监控和分析功能。其中,推荐的产品包括:

  1. 云监控(Cloud Monitor):提供了丰富的监控指标和告警功能,可以与Prometheus集成,实现更全面的监控和告警。
  2. 云日志服务(Cloud Log Service):提供了日志收集、存储和分析的能力,可以与Prometheus结合使用,实现更全面的日志分析和监控。
  3. 云数据库时序数据库(Cloud TSDB):提供了高性能的时序数据存储和查询服务,可以与Prometheus结合使用,实现更高效的指标数据存储和查询。

以上是关于Prometheus Python查看公制的当前值的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• git log 查看 当前分支 提交历史

    大家好,又见面了,我是你们朋友全栈君 git log 查看 当前分支 提交历史 在提交了若干更新之后,想回顾下提交历史,可以使用 git log 命令查看 默认不用任何参数的话,git log 会按提交时间列出所有的更新...,最近更新排在最上面。...git log 有许多选项可以帮助你搜寻感兴趣提交,接下来我们介绍些最常用。...我们常用 -p 选项 展开显示每次提交内容差异,用 -2 则仅显示最近两次更新: $ git log -p -2 此外,还有许多摘要选项可以用,比如 --stat,仅简要显示 文件 增改行数统计,...每个提交都列出了修改过文件,以及其中添加和移除行数,并在最后列出所有增减行数小计。

    4.6K20

    JVM问题定位 | 查看当前线程信息,查看线程堆栈?

    这里cpu使用率与linux 命令top-H-p线程%CPU类似,一段采样间隔时间内,当前JVM里各个线程增量cpu时间与采样间隔时间比例。...CPU时间 / 采样间隔时间 * 100% 注意:这个统计也会产生一定开销(JDK这个接口本身开销比较大),因此会看到as线程占用一定百分比,为了降低统计自身开销带来影响,可以把采样间隔拉长一些...使用参考 当前最忙前N个线程并打印堆栈: 没有线程ID,包含[Internal]表示为JVM内部线程,参考dashboard命令介绍。...- thread id, 显示指定线程运行堆栈 - thread -b, 找出当前阻塞其他线程线程 有时候我们发现应用卡住了, 通常是由于某个线程拿住了某个锁, 并且其他线程都在等待这把锁造成。...thread-n3-i1000 : 列出1000ms内最忙3个线程栈 - thread –state ,查看指定状态线程

    3.1K20

    linux查看运行中java_linux怎么查看当前进程

    大家好,又见面了,我是你们朋友全栈君。 【www.hyheiban.com–知识文库】 在linux系统下可以通过命令查看进程,那么具体是那个命令呢?...下面由小编为大家整理了linux查看进程命令,希望对大家有帮助!...一、linux查看进程命令 有ps、pstree、pgrep等 1、ps 显示进程信息,参数可省略 -aux 以BSD风格显示进程 常用 -efH 以System V风格显示进程 -e , -A 显示所有进程...a 显示终端上所有用户进程 x 显示无终端进程 u 显示详细信息 f 树状显示 w 完整显示信息 l 显示长列表 各列输出字段含义: USER 进程所有者 PID 进程ID PPID 父进程 %CPU...-9 -1 结束当前用户所有进程 pkill 结束进程族。

    13K20

    python获取当前系统日期_python怎么获取当前系统时间

    python获取当前系统时间,包括年月日,时分秒,主要通过Pythondatetime模块来实现。 下面我们就通过具体代码示例,给大家详细介绍Python获取当前时间日期实现方法。...代码示例如下:import datetime now = datetime.datetime.now() print (“当前系统日期和时间是: “) print (now.strftime(“%Y-%...m-%d %H:%M:%S”)) 获取当前系统时间,结果如下所示: Python datetime: datetime模块提供了以简单和复杂方式操作日期和时间类。...now(tz=None)返回当前本地日期和时间。如果可选参数tz没有指定,与today()一样。 strftime(format)返回一个表示日期字符串,由显式格式字符串控制。...引用小时、分钟或秒格式代码将看到0。 本篇文章就是关于Python获取当前系统时间及日期方法介绍,也很简单易懂,希望对需要朋友有所帮助!

    6.2K90

    如何查看当前目录下文件夹大小

    du -sh*查看当前目录下文件夹大小 u 命令 用途 概述磁盘使用。...如果指定File参数实际上是一个目录,就要报告该目录内所有文件。如果没有提供 File参数,du命令使用当前目录内文件。...-g 用 GB 单位计算块数,而不是用缺省 512 字节单位。对磁盘使用情况输出要用浮点数,这是因为如果用字节为单位的话,会非常大。...根据缺省,有两个或者更多链接文件只计数一次。 -L 如果在命令行指定了符号链接或者在文件层次结构遍历中多次遇到符号链接,则 du 命令应统计链接引用文件或文件层次结构大小。...-m 用 MB 单位计算块数,而不是用缺省 512 字节单位。对磁盘使用情况输出要用浮点数,这是因为如果用字节为单位的话,会非常大。 -r 报告不可访问文件或者目录名。此为缺省设置。

    3.2K50
    领券